Key Takeaways:

  • The evolution of game controllers has transformed the gaming experience, from simple joysticks to complex motion sensors, enhancing player engagement and immersion.
  • Early game controllers, such as the Magnavox Odyssey, introduced basic button and joystick configurations, laying the groundwork for future innovations.
  • The introduction of the D-pad and analog sticks in the 1980s and 1990s revolutionized controller design, allowing for more precise character movement and control.
  • The incorporation of vibration feedback, triggers, and bumper buttons further expanded the sensory experience, drawing players deeper into the game world.
  • Motion sensors and gesture recognition technology, popularized by the Nintendo Wii and Microsoft Kinect, enabled new types of gameplay and attracted a broader audience to gaming.
  • Modern game controllers, such as those for the PlayStation and Xbox, feature advanced ergonomics, wireless connectivity, and share buttons, reflecting a focus on comfort, convenience, and social sharing.
  • The ongoing evolution of game controllers is driven by advancements in technology, changing player preferences, and the rise of new gaming platforms, such as virtual and augmented reality systems.

Q: What were the first game controllers like and how did they evolve over time?

A: The first game controllers were simple joysticks and buttons, used in the early days of arcade games and home consoles. These early controllers were basic and limited in their functionality, but they paved the way for the development of more complex and sophisticated controllers. Over time, game controllers evolved to include additional features such as directional pads, analog sticks, and shoulder buttons, allowing for more precise and immersive gameplay. The introduction of motion sensors and gesture recognition technology in modern controllers has further enhanced the gaming experience, enabling players to interact with games in new and innovative ways.
